Jobs are processed on a z/OS system by a job entry subsystem, JES2 or JES3. Each JES subsystem schedules the work moving through the computer and performs spooling operations. Although the two z/OS job entry subsystems have similar names, they evolved from two different sources. JES2 is the z/OS version of HASP (Houston Automatic Spooling and Priority System) and JES3 is the z/OS version of ASP (Asymmetric Processing System).
